TINUBU’s EMERGENCE AS APC FLAGBEARER FOR 2027 POLLS WILL SOLIDIFY REFORMS- TMV

The Tinubu Media Volunteers (TMV) has acknowledged the victory secured by President Bola Ahmed Tinubu at the just-ended All Progressives Congress (APC) presidential primaries as well-deserved.

In a statement signed by its Chairman Chukwudi Enekwechi and Secretary Segun Ogedengbe, TMV noted that the extensive economic reforms he initiated since assuming office on May 29 2023 are necessary in spite of the temporary pains.

It said: We believe that despite the hardship associated with the reforms of the Tinubu administration, the long-term benefits are foreseeable, and will ultimately work for all Nigerians.
“While it is true that the generality of Nigerians are going through pains due to the removal of fuel subsidy and the harmonisation of the forex window, we believe that the reforms are necessary to restore the country to the path of growth and development.

“We are also confident that President Tinubu’s emergence as Presidential candidate at the primary election will cement his achievements in infrastructure such as roads, power, stabilization in the exchange rates, the student loan fund, CREDICORP, increased monthly allocations to the states, expansion and development of agriculture and food production thereby enhancing food security, massive infrastructural development in the Federal Capital Territory during his second term.

“We are glad that the President also acknowledged in his ‘’Thank you all’’ advertorial that though the journey has been challenging, the future remains promising.

“We are gratified that the president remains focused on delivering on the Renewed Hope Agenda which if religiously implemented has the potential to transform the country remarkably.”

It also appealed to Nigerians to continue to render the Tinubu administration the necessary support ahead of the 2027 elections.
